Artificial Intelligence Is Already Making War More Horrific

The United States is using artificial intelligence in its war with Iran. The military says the “variety” of AI systems in use is dedicated to sorting data, deployed as tools and not as agents. The chief of America’s Central Command, Brad Cooper, says AI systems assist the armed forces, allowing them to “sift through vast amounts of data in seconds so our leaders can cut through the noise and make smarter decisions faster than the enemy can react.”

AI will speed up the pace of target acquisition and firing, and thus the pace of war, death, destruction, and whatever comes in the aftermath. Cooper insists that humans make the final call. That’s less reassuring than it’s meant to be. A recent report notes that “the targets for Operation Epic Fury were identified with the aid of the National Geospatial-Intelligence Agency’s Maven Smart System, which folds in data from surveillance and intelligence, among other data points, and can lay out the information on a dashboard to support officials in their decision-making.”

Nevertheless, we’re told that AI tools don’t “explicitly create” targets; they merely “identify potential points of interest for military intelligence.” This is a bit like saying that information doesn’t impact decisions — as if intelligence placed before a commander has nothing to do with where a strike is ordered.

If the February 28 bombing of Shajarah Tayyebeh elementary school in Iran was the result of an AI tool “folding in” old military intelligence to Maven’s dashboard, it means that AI effectively shaped the ostensibly human “final call.” Sure, Cooper’s soothing reassurance that human military personnel are supposedly still in the cockpit may well be true. Nevertheless, adding AI into the matrix of targeting systems and acting on its recommendations amounts to AI military decision-making, however much humans may still pull the trigger.
